The Boeing Safety, Security, and Airworthiness (SS&A) organization is seeking an Entry Level (Level 1) or Associate (Level 2) Airplane Safety Engineer to join their Airplane Safety Engineering Team within Enterprise Safety Mission Assurance in Everett, WA. In this role, you will work cross functionally to conduct comprehensive airplane safety analyses, ensuring regulatory compliance, design integrity and effective integration of complex aerospace systems.

Key Responsibilities

  • Contribute by documenting safety analysis, hazard mitigation, validation, and verification activities in compliance with relevant customer and regulatory safety standards.
  • Execute airplane level analyses within the Preliminary Aircraft Safety Assessment and Aircraft Safety Assessment (including techniques like Aircraft Functional Hazard Assessment (AFHA), Combined Functional Failure Effects (CoFFE), Multi-Functional Fault Tree Analysis (MFTA), and others).
  • Provide safety design and analysis expertise to program stakeholders and leadership.
  • Validate and verify airplane level safety requirements.
  • Develop certification strategies for addressing systems and airplane level safety issues.
  • Represent the Airplane Safety Engineering team in design trade studies, coordination of safety analyses, and functional integration assessments.
  • Ensure adequate redundancy and physical separation of critical systems.
  • Lead airplane level safety analyses such as Runway Excursion or Airplane Common Mode to ensure integration across multiple functional systems.
  • Utilize Model Based System Engineering tools to analyze architectures/designs and develop safety deliverables.

Preferred Qualifications

  • 1+ years of experience performing and/or reviewing system safety analyses or studies.
  • 1+ years of experience with commercial airplane certification, including participation in regulator-facing forums.
  • Working knowledge (1+ years) of Functional Hazard Analyses (FHA), Failure Mode and Effects Analysis (FMEA), Particular Risk Assessment (PRA), Fault Trees Analysis (FTA), and/or System Safety Assessments (SSA).
  • Experience in developing or applying aviation-related system safety analysis methods, such as System Safety Risk Assessments, Fault Tree Analysis, or Functional Hazard Assessment.
  • Operational experience and/or a Pilot’s license.
  • Experience in solving complex, ambiguous engineering problems within an aerospace design environment.
  • Familiarity with 14CFR Part 25.1309, SAE ARP-4754, and SAE ARP-4761.
